Зафиксировать и распознать объект

JollyBiber
JollyBiber аватар
Offline
Зарегистрирован: 08.05.2012

Вопрос на засыпку. Есть соревнования среди квадрокоптеров - кто быстрее пролетит "трассу" помеченную воротами, ворота расставленны хаотически в 3-х координатах, размер ворот приерно 2м*2м. Нужно распозновать "кто" пролетел и соответственно время считать. Стартуют по 5 квадрокоптеров одновременно. Самый простой выход - RFID, но к сожалению цена зашкаливает (соревнования проводятся энтузиастами). Вторая проблема - вес "передатчика" не должен превышать 40 грамм, и третья проблема - практически все НЛО самоделки, поэтому радиопередатчики на 2,4GHz, 5,8GHz и 433MHz использовать нельзя... Ах да, скорость "пролетания" ворот может достигать 70км/ч

Единственное что смог пока придумать ИК-передатчик / приемник и 2 направленных друг на друга дальномера. Но не уверен что успею считать импульс.

С радостью выслушаю любые идеи по теме и язвительные комментарии :)

 

Araris
Offline
Зарегистрирован: 09.11.2012

Мда, действительно на засыпку.

1. Правильно ли я понимаю, что и RFID, и "передатчик" сработают независимо от того, внутри ворот, либо близко снаружи ворот пролетел квадрокоптер ? Или это контролируется человеками визуально ?

2.

JollyBiber пишет:

Единственное что смог пока придумать ИК-передатчик / приемник и 2 направленных друг на друга дальномера. Но не уверен что успею считать импульс.

Но Вам же надо различать их между собой как-то ?

3. Что представляют собой ворота, сколько ворот может быть на маршруте ?

4. Могут ли аппараты пролетать ворота одновременно (наверное, да) ?

P.S. За язвительными комментариями - к СамиЗнаетеКому, думаю, он не замедлит появиться в этой теме.

 

JollyBiber
JollyBiber аватар
Offline
Зарегистрирован: 08.05.2012

Araris пишет:

1. Правильно ли я понимаю, что и RFID, и "передатчик" сработают независимо от того, внутри ворот, либо близко снаружи ворот пролетел квадрокоптер ? Или это контролируется человеками визуально ?

2.

JollyBiber пишет:

Единственное что смог пока придумать ИК-передатчик / приемник и 2 направленных друг на друга дальномера. Но не уверен что успею считать импульс.

Но Вам же надо различать их между собой как-то ?

3. Что представляют собой ворота, сколько ворот может быть на маршруте ?

4. Могут ли аппараты пролетать ворота одновременно (наверное, да) ?

1. Я думал или/или, в идеале должно контролироваться программно, сейчас один смотрит чтобы в ворота пролетал, второй секундомер стопает

2. В идее была разные импульсы в ИК, а дальномеры именно чтобы определить пролетел ли в ворота

3. Рамка из "легколомающегося" материала. До 40

4. Да, могут

Клапауций
Offline
Зарегистрирован: 10.02.2013

Лепишь на спины коптеров цветные круглые метки, ворота обозначаешь двумя белыми метками, под потолком вешаешь камеру, на комп софт, анализирующий видео-картинку на предмет времени прохождения цветного между белым - как-то так.

JollyBiber
JollyBiber аватар
Offline
Зарегистрирован: 08.05.2012

На открытом воздухе проводится, я там до потолка не дотянусь ))) И они не всегда спиной кверху летают

leshak
Offline
Зарегистрирован: 29.09.2011

>цена зашкаливает (соревнования проводятся энтузиастами).

Да вообщем-то по сравнению с тем сколько энтузиасты вкидывают в свои коптеры - IMHO цена вообще коппеечная.

>все НЛО самоделки, поэтому радиопередатчики на 2,4GHz, 5,8GHz и 433MHz использовать нельзя.

Не понял как это связанно - но не важно :)

Можно попробовать Color Sensor и налепить на НЛО бумажки.

Но IMHO идеальное решение - это когда в само НЛО вообще не требуется вмешательства. Не надежно (в том числе и ИК) плюс возможность мухлежа (помехи создавать и т.п.)

Даже если мухлежа не будет - это не помешает обвинить организаторов (в подтасовке, в бажности системы и т.п.)

Вообщем если поставить запрет на модификацию самих аппаратов - приходим к идинственному варианту - старый добрый фотофиниш с видео-фиксацией. Плюс записаное видео это и интерестно и, в случае конфликтов, шанс разобратся "кто кому рабинович".

Распознованием видео "кто пролетел", можно конечно заморочится ноутом каким-то, но... IMHO полуручной режим, когда арудина фиксирует вреям, а человек отмечает "кто в кадре" - вполне достаточно.

Вообщем я бы делел фотофиниш с помощью лазерных указок. Плюс выводил бы какой-то библиотекой для формирование OSD поверх сигнала с камеры и записывал бы это какой-то плайто видео-захавата/TV-тюнером. Что-бы на видео было видно "кто пролетел" и точное время пролета.

http://www.youtube.com/watch?v=TGy70XxhpMY&feature=player_embedded#t=10

http://youtu.be/JZdY-gRe0jw?t=50s

 

 

 

 

Araris
Offline
Зарегистрирован: 09.11.2012

Клапауций пишет:

Лепишь на спины коптеров цветные круглые метки, ворота обозначаешь двумя белыми метками, под потолком вешаешь камеру, на комп софт, анализирующий видео-картинку на предмет времени прохождения цветного между белым - как-то так.

О, первое о чем и я подумал. Но :

1. Одна камера вряд ли накроет всю трассу, в идеале одна камера = одни ворота, сложно и дорого.

2. А если дрон пролетел "над", или "под", трехмерка же.

3. Если два дрона пролетают одновременно, один перекрывает метку другого, тоже фигня получается.

(И еще ряд более мелких "но".)

Клапауций
Offline
Зарегистрирован: 10.02.2013

Araris пишет:

О, первое о чем и я подумал. Но :

1. Одна камера вряд ли накроет всю трассу, в идеале одна камера = одни ворота, сложно и дорого.

2. А если дрон пролетел "над", или "под", трехмерка же.

3. Если два дрона пролетают одновременно, один перекрывает метку другого, тоже фигня получается.

(И еще ряд более мелких "но".)

Тогда не парить себе мосг, как совместить дешёвое с хорошим - писать простое видео на максимальное количество, имеющихся в хозяйстве камер, а судить руками/глазами.

JollyBiber
JollyBiber аватар
Offline
Зарегистрирован: 08.05.2012

leshak пишет:

Да вообщем-то по сравнению с тем сколько энтузиасты вкидывают в свои коптеры - IMHO цена вообще коппеечная.

Самая дешевая читалка которую нашел - 500 зеленых * 40 ворот = 20к Учитывая что соревнования устраивают энтузиасты....

leshak пишет:

>все НЛО самоделки, поэтому радиопередатчики на 2,4GHz, 5,8GHz и 433MHz использовать нельзя.

Не понял как это связанно - но не важно :)

Была идея сделать "ну очень слабенький передатчик"

leshak пишет:

Вообщем я бы делел фотофиниш с помощью лазерных указок. Плюс выводил бы какой-то библиотекой для формирование OSD поверх сигнала с камеры и записывал бы это какой-то плайто видео-захавата/TV-тюнером. Что-бы на видео было видно "кто пролетел" и точное время пролета.

Фотофиниш на каждые ворота? %)

Клапауций
Offline
Зарегистрирован: 10.02.2013

Не - 40 ворот, это только цифровую обработку видео нужно городить, иначе разоришься на датчиках, сколько бы они не стоили.

toc
Offline
Зарегистрирован: 09.02.2013

JollyBiber пишет:

Самая дешевая читалка которую нашел - 500 зеленых

если в ебэе искать arduino rfid  - макс.цена будет около 25$. Но для работы нужно расстояние 5 см.

А вот в магазинах на выходе стоят рамки, которые на украденные товары реагируют. Как они работают? Могут ли не только наличие метки чувствовать?

mixail844
Offline
Зарегистрирован: 30.04.2012

у меня есть идея :

Добавить направленные ИК излучатели по :2 на каждый квадрокоптер - однин размещаеться перпедникулярно верхней плоскости,второй перпендикулярно одной из боковых  - так что оба излучателя перпендикулярны друг другу(исхося из предположения,что у любого квадрокоптера есть условное направление полета "вперед"),причем для каждого участника свой уникальный сигнал излучения,или собственная частота.На воротах нацепить 3 приемника - 1 на полу, и 2 на воротах должно хватить,ардуинами отслеживать пересечение.

Как бы квадрокоптеры не пролетели через ворота 1 или 2 приемника зафиксируют пролет.

Ну или в конце концов внести в условие конкурса пролет в опредленном положении + сами передатчики раз уже квадрокоптеры собрали то передатчик с изменяемой передачей данных собрать не составит труда.

JollyBiber
JollyBiber аватар
Offline
Зарегистрирован: 08.05.2012

Вот как раз такие и дорогие ))

JollyBiber
JollyBiber аватар
Offline
Зарегистрирован: 08.05.2012

Идея рассматривалась, вопрос успеет ли считать на скорости в 70 кмч?

Puhlyaviy
Puhlyaviy аватар
Offline
Зарегистрирован: 22.05.2013

ну тут все довольно просто...

датчики нужно вешать не на воротах, а на самих квадракоптерах... .. тоесть  коробку датчик+ передатчик.. тогда датчиков понадобится всего 5 штук.. перевешивать их с квадракоптера на квадрокоптер.. а в сами ворота встроить хотя бы теже светодиоды инфракрасные. по нижней планке... соотвественно датчик будет в виде сенсора.. что бы кое кто не баловался на одних воротах летая взад вперед, можно сделать 2 датчика типа сигнал посылать когда оба сработали последовательно..

приемник сигналов подключаем на комп и там ведем всю статистику... соотвественно разобрать сигналы от 5 передатчиков которые шлют БИП в момент когда пересекают рамку вполне себе легко и вполне они могут слать БИП1 первый передатчик БИП2 второй  передатчик... на старте сделать стартовую рамку для чистоты эксперемента и установки начальной точки отсчета...

бюджет копеешный :)

гонорар высылай чумаданом :)

Puhlyaviy
Puhlyaviy аватар
Offline
Зарегистрирован: 22.05.2013

а еще проще вариант... ворота изнутри обклеить отражающей фигней и светодиод  разместить на квадракоптере рядом с сенсором.. и будет вообще халява...